IELTS Writing Task 2 question

Some people believe that allowing children to make their own choices on everyday matters (such as food, clothes and entertainment) is likely to result in a society of individuals who only think about their own wishes. Other people believe that it is important for children to make decisions about matters that affect them.

Discuss both these views and give your own opinion.

Give reasons for your answer and include any relevant examples from your own knowledge or experience.

Task Achievement / Task Response — Band 5.5

The essay demonstrates a clear understanding of the task by discussing both views regarding children's freedom of choice. The introduction sets up the argument effectively, and the conclusion summarizes the main points. However, the arguments presented could be more developed, particularly in supporting claims with relevant examples. The negative outcomes of children making their own choices are highlighted, but this could benefit from more detailed examples. Overall, the task achievement is moderate as the response addresses the prompt but lacks depth in some arguments.

Coherence and Cohesion — Band 5.5

The essay has a logical structure with an introduction, body paragraphs discussing both sides of the argument, and a conclusion. However, some cohesion is lacking, particularly in transitions between ideas. For example, phrases like "However, some time given freedom to make their own choice..." could be clearer. The use of linking words varies; introducing contrasting ideas could be more consistent. More effective sentence linking would enhance the flow, thus improving coherence. Overall, coherence and cohesion are reasonably good but need refinement.

Lexical Resource — Band 5.5

The lexical resource in this essay shows a decent range, but word choice can be simplified or vague at times. Phrases like "expand their vocabulary" and "given freedom" are clear but could be expressed with greater sophistication. The use of informal language and imprecise phrases like "involving in gang fights" impacts the overall impression. For example, instead of "children do not know the value of certain things," a more academic phrase could be used. Overall, vocabulary use is adequate, but more variety and precision would elevate the writing.

Grammatical Range and Accuracy — Band 5.5

Grammatical range is reasonably varied, using a mix of simple and complex sentences. However, there are several grammatical mistakes such as "children might make wrong decisions that will affect them later..." which could be rephrased more clearly. The use of article forms and prepositions is inconsistent: for instance, "to make decision about matters" should be "to make decisions about matters." Additionally, syntax errors do occasionally hinder clarity. Overall, the grammatical range is adequate, but accuracy should be improved.
